Solar Potential in Antioch
Antioch's solar potential is impressive, with approximately 5.5 to 6 hours of peak sunlight per day, making it an ideal location for solar energy production. The Mediterranean climate, characterized by hot, dry summers and mild, wet winters, supports efficient solar panel performance throughout the year. Homeowners with south-facing roofs typically achieve optimal energy generation, while those with west-facing roofs still benefit significantly. The local climate ensures that solar panels can operate effectively, providing substantial energy savings and a reliable return on investment.

Solar Installation Tips for Antioch Homeowners
When considering solar installation in Antioch, homeowners should start by researching and selecting qualified solar installers. It's wise to obtain multiple quotes to compare prices and services. Ensure that the installers are licensed and have experience with local regulations and permitting processes. Be mindful of homeowners' association (HOA) guidelines, as some HOAs may have specific requirements for solar installations. Additionally, consider the timeline for installation, which can vary based on permitting and weather conditions. Planning ahead and understanding the steps involved will help facilitate a smooth installation process.
